How Much Does Chimney Flashing Repairs Pontypridd Cost?
The cost of chimney flashing repairs in Pontypridd will vary depending on the extent of the damage, the materials required, and the accessibility of your chimney stack. Here are some typical price ranges to give you a general guide:
- Flashing repointing (mortar only): £150 – £300 for a standard single chimney stack, depending on the amount of repointing required.
- Partial lead flashing replacement: £250 – £500 for replacing a section of lead flashing around the base or sides of a chimney.
- Full lead flashing replacement: £450 – £900 for a complete strip and re-lay of all lead flashing around an average chimney stack.
- Step and soaker flashing replacement: £300 – £650 depending on the number of courses and complexity of the join between the chimney and roof slope.
- Chimney stack inspection and minor repairs: £100 – £200 for a survey with small-scale remedial work such as minor mortar repairs or sealant application.

What is chimney flashing and why does it fail?
Chimney flashing is the waterproof seal — typically lead, aluminium, or mortar — fitted where your chimney meets the roof surface. Over time, it can crack, lift, or corrode due to weathering, thermal movement, or poor original installation. When it fails, rainwater can penetrate the roof structure causing damp and internal damage.
How do I know if my chimney flashing needs repairing?
Common signs include damp patches or water stains on ceilings near the chimney breast, peeling wallpaper or plaster around the chimney, a musty smell in the loft, or visibly cracked and loose mortar or lead flashing when viewed from ground level or through binoculars.
Is it better to repair or replace chimney flashing?
This depends on the age and condition of the existing flashing. If the lead or mortar has only minor cracks or lifted sections, targeted repairs are often sufficient. If the flashing is extensively corroded, poorly fitted, or very old, a full replacement will provide a more reliable and cost-effective long-term solution.
How long does chimney flashing last once repaired?
Good quality lead flashing, when properly fitted, can last 50 years or more. Mortar-based flashing tends to have a shorter lifespan of around 10–20 years. Using modern flexible pointing systems alongside lead can significantly extend the life of your chimney flashing repairs.
Can chimney flashing repairs be carried out in winter?
Yes, in most cases chimney flashing repairs can be completed throughout the year. Lead work is not temperature-dependent in the same way as mortar, though we do avoid working during heavy frost or ice. Do I need scaffolding for chimney flashing repairs?
It depends on the height and accessibility of your chimney stack. For many standard two-storey properties, our roofers can access the chimney safely using ladders and roof ladders. For taller or more complex properties, scaffold may be recommended for safety — we’ll advise clearly on this during your free survey.
